CGMS CRC Check Control (C/W04)  
When this bit is enabled (1), the last six bits of the CGMS data  
(that is, the CRC check sequence) are calculated internally by  
the ADV7170/ADV7171. If this bit is disabled (0), the CRC  
values in the register are output to the CGMS data stream.

WSS Control (C/W07)  
When this bit is set (1), wide screen signaling is enabled. Note  
this is valid only in PAL mode.
